On 10/04/2012 12:29 PM, Peter Maydell wrote:
> On 4 October 2012 11:15, Avi Kivity <address@hidden> wrote:
>> On 10/04/2012 10:47 AM, Peter Maydell wrote:
>>> I'd favour just moving everything to 64 bits (the remaining
>>> 32 bit targets are: cris, lm32, m68k, microblaze, or32, sh4, unicore32,
>>> xtensa). However it does require some review of devices to check that
>>> they're not using target_phys_addr_t when they meant uint32_t [eg
>>> in registers for DMA devices] or relying on 32 bit wraparound.
>>
>> I posted a patch.  I did no review, the cost/benefit tradeoff is
>> horrible IMO, especially with me not knowing the details.  If something
>> breaks, git bisect will save the day.
> 
> It might be nice to cc the maintainers of the affected target archs
> and suggest that they at least do a quick smoke test :-)

Yes, will do.
